SXT rims on my 1st gen?

Post by FlowmasterNeon » Wed Feb 15, 2012 9:08 pm

I want to buy some SXT rims from craigslist but I want to know if they'll swap right over easy. I do have the 5 lug bolt pattern. I don't want my tires to rub either.. also, what would be a good offer to pay for these rims?

Post by ricker91878 » Wed Feb 15, 2012 10:28 pm

I think sxt wheels are 16's so you should be okay, the bolt pattern is the same, just make sure the tread on the tires is good so you don't have to worry about new tires for a while. If the tires are in pretty good shape I'd say $250-300 would be fair, otherwise $150-200, I live close to Orlando FL and thats about what they go for down here, srt's go for $350-400 so I'd say depending on where you live the price is negotiable, good luck!
